Table 9   Security Setting: WEP 
LABEL
DESCRIPTION
Security Settings
WEP
Select 64 Bits or 128 Bits to activate WEP encryption and then fill in the related 
fields.
Authentication 
Type
Select an authentication method. Choices are Open and Shared.
Refer to 
Section 3.3.1.1.2 on page 39 
for more information.
Pass Phrase
Enter a passphrase of up to 32 case-sensitive printable characters. As you enter 
the passphrase, the NWD-270N automatically generates four different WEP keys 
and displays the first in the key field below. Refer to 
Section 3.3.1.1.1 on page 39
 
for more information.
Transmit Key
Select a default WEP key to use for data encryption. The key displays in the 
adjacent field.
Key x (where x is 
a number 
between 1 and 4)
Select this option if you want to manually enter the WEP keys. Enter the WEP key 
in the field provided.
If you select 64 Bits in the WEP field.
Enter either 10 hexadecimal digits in the range of “A-F”, “a-f” and “0-9” (for 
example, 11AA22BB33) for HEX key type.
or
Enter 5 ASCII characters (case sensitive) ranging from “a-z”, “A-Z” and “0-9” 
(for example, MyKey) for ASCII key type. 
If you select 128 Bits in the WEP field,
Enter either 26 hexadecimal digits in the range of “A-F”, “a-f” and “0-9” (for 
example, 00112233445566778899AABBCC) for HEX key type
or
Enter 13 ASCII characters (case sensitive) ranging from “a-z”, “A-Z” and “0-9” 
(for example, MyKey12345678) for ASCII key type.
Note: The values for the WEP keys must be set up exactly the 
same on all wireless devices in the same wireless LAN. 
ASCII WEP keys are case sensitive.
